How Airplane Flying & Landing Games Actually Create That Pilot Feel
These games simulate authentic flight mechanics, from pre-flight checks and navigation through weather patterns to precision landings under variable conditions. Players engage core cognitive skills: spatial awareness, quick decision-making, and situational judgment—mirroring real pilot challenges without physical risk. Unlike casual racing or puzzle games, flight simulators emphasize real-world aerodynamics and aircraft performance, offering a learning curve that rewards attention to detail. The combination of visual fidelity, responsive controls, and dynamic outcomes deepens immersion, helping users genuinely feel like they’re managing an aircraft—even temporarily.

How realistic are flight controls?
Most modern titles replicate actual cockpit instruments and flight dynamics, calibrated to mirror real aircraft behavior within accessible limits.
Do I need prior experience to enjoy these games?
Not at all—introductory modes ease new players through basics, while advanced settings challenge seasoned gamers.
Are these games safe for all age groups?
Yes. Designed with intuitive controls and educational layers, they remain appropriate for broad demographics, especially with parental oversight for under-16s.
How do I get started without costly equipment?
Most games launch on mobile and desktop platforms with intuitive touch or controller interfaces—no simulator hardware required.
What topics do these games typically cover?
Simulations focus on navigation, weather adaptations, emergency procedures, fuel management, and precision landings.

Clear Myths: What’s Not True About These Games
- Myth: Playing makes you a real pilot.
Fact: Simulators teach conceptual knowledge and flight principles, not actual licensing. - Myth: You need expensive gear to play.
Fact: Many mobile and browser-based versions deliver high-quality experiences without specialized hardware. - Myth: These games replace real-world pilot training.
Fact: They complement education but cannot replicate hands-on experience and regulated instruction.
